SW3 6QH is an up-and-coming urban area on Bury Walk, 0.3km from Chelsea in Kensington and Chelsea. Administratively it sits within Stanley ward and the Kensington constituency.
An affordable area with active regeneration, SW3 6QH is a diverse renting area with many ethnic minority families, mostly European-born. By day, the area transitions to a independent professional metro services character: higher status cosmopolitan professional services and self-employment. An average age of 40 puts this squarely in mixed-family territory — professional couples, school-age children households, and established residents all sharing the streets. 64% of homes are socially rented, reflecting the area's public housing provision and council presence. The area has a notably diverse population — 49% of residents identify as non-white, reflecting the multicultural character of this part of Kensington and Chelsea.
Safety: Crime rates are above average at 113 incidents per 1,000 residents — worth reviewing the crime breakdown below.
Census 2021 statistics for SW3 6QH are sourced from Output Area E00014112 (shared with 10 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
